What is SUPER Hi-VISION (SHV)? n Ultra high definition image with 16 times large pixel count as that of HDTV. n 22.2 multi-channel threedimensional sound system 3
Outline of Public Viewings n Dates : July 27(Fri.) -- August 12(Sun.), 2012 n Contents : Live or edited feeds of the opening ceremony and several sports (updated several times) n PV venues : Japan (3), UK (3), and USA (1) IBC (145 SHV Plasma demo) (International Broadcasting Centre) Fukushima Akihabara in Tokyo NHK in Tokyo Washington D.C Glasgow Bradford London BBC IBC BBC:TC0 Studio 4

Concept of SHV Production n To make viewers feel as if they were there. n Video - Fewer cuts - Wider shot - Slower camera motion n Audio - Immersive 3D sound - No commentary 6

Video n Two cameras + additional one fixed camera n Up convertor from 2K to 8K n DWDM transmitter n Switcher with slow play and super impose n Two SHV recorders 8

Camera n 1.25-inch 4-CMOS camera n 5x, 10x, wide lenses 11

Audio n 22.2 multichannel microphone n Digital mixing desk with 3D panner n MADI router n Digital audio workstation 13

Live and two version of edited programs n Live programs n One-hour highlight package programs n New events were added along the Olympic schedule existing clips were re-edited to fit into the program n Different interest in different region n Japan Feed: Six highlights of 50 min. and one live n World Feed: Six highlights of 50 min. and four lives 20

Audience feedback n It was just like I was watching it at the Olympic Stadium. n I felt as if I understood what the realistic sensation is for the first time. n The impact was great that I could almost smell and feel the fireworks at the opening ceremony. n Felt like the person behind me was clapping. n Could see the natural 3D image. n Could clearly see the person who threw a bottle at Bolt. n Want to believe this is the first step to the next generation TV. n Blurring with pan shot is bothering. n Image is very clear but it needs a large screen size and is questionable whether it fits to home viewing. 38

What we have learned. [Viewing experience] n Audience could feel as if they were at the Olympic venues n Home viewing use-case demonstrated with 85 LCD Needs for this kind of media has been shown again. [System and operation] n Produced the programs everyday during the Olympic period n Conducted multipoint transmission with live coverage and recorded/edited contents n SHV production with the same workflow as HDTV Feasibility of SHV broadcasting in the near future has been shown. [New form of program] Broadcasters has shown their surprise and admiration on the new technique of direction and production of the SHV contents. SHV is recognized as a new possibility of the broadcasting industry. 40
